Output 901f8e3f69c541c578e040e1cc92fa656e68788f1163e22a93921c18a2e28b3a:2

value
240782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c49206bbe3f96e12c927a0e4438b799117415e OP_EQUAL
address
3QNNz4zMR5UrXiYAix4kQJUno11fWxBtX1
transaction
901f8e3f69c541c578e040e1cc92fa656e68788f1163e22a93921c18a2e28b3a
confirmations
306359
spent
true